"The Last Leaf" by O. Henry has a plot that revolves around the themes of sacrifice and hope. The story follows two young artists, Johnsy and Sue, living in Greenwich Village. When Johnsy falls ill with pneumonia and believes she will die when the last ivy leaf falls from a vine outside her window, a neighboring artist named Mr. Behrman paints a leaf on the wall to give her hope. In the end, the real last leaf stays on the vine, saving Johnsy's life and revealing Behrman's ultimate sacrifice for the young girls.

The range is the difference between the maximum score and the minimum score. Let's look at an example. [Figure2] The smallest number in the stem-and-leaf plot is 22. You can see that by looking at the first stem and the first leaf. The greatest number is the last stem and the last leaf on the chart. In this case, the largest number is 55. To find the range, subtract the smallest number from the largest number. This difference will give you the range. 55 - 22 = 33 The range is 33 for this set of data.
